Shangri La's 248 homes were built out between 1978 and 2023, with a typical build year of 1981 and a median size of 1,437 square feet — a mix that puts real weight on condition and updates when it comes to pricing. The median sale price currently sits at $205,000, or $160.32 per square foot.

Right now the market favors buyers: 12 months of supply against only four active listings, and a median 57 days on market. Year-over-year pricing is down 24.1%, though that's measured against just three closings in the window, so treat it as directional, not definitive. The longer arc is different — prices are up 109% since 2012. My read: this is a market to negotiate in, not chase.

The 60-Second Overview

Shangri La market snapshot (as of July 12, 2026): the median sale price is about $205K ($160 per sq ft over the trailing 12 months of closed sales), a median 57 days on market for closed sales, and 12.0 months of supply, a buyer-leaning market. The trailing-12-month median is down 24% from the prior 12 months and up 109% since 2012, computed from record-level DBAMLS closed sales (3 closings in the current window).

Shangri La is a community of 248 homes in Daytona Beach, Volusia County, built between 1978 and 2023 (median 1981.0), with a median living area of about 1,437 square feet. 66% of parcels are homesteaded, the owner-occupancy proxy in the Florida DOR assessment roll (2025 roll, public records).

Shangri La is a modest, well-established pocket of Daytona Beach with homes built as far back as 1978 and as recently as 2023. Current MLS listings show no distinct community amenities, so the draw here is the home and lot rather than shared facilities.

    If we were buying in Shangri La, this is the order of operations we would run, and the one we run for our clients.

    1

    Underwrite the condition. On a late-1970s home, price the roof, panel, plumbing, and HVAC honestly before you judge any list price.

    2

    Confirm any HOA. Older Daytona neighborhoods vary; verify whether an association applies and what it covers.

    3

    Get insurance quotes early. Roof and systems age drive insurability and premium; quote inside the inspection window.

    4

    Pull the flood zone. Confirm the FEMA designation for the exact parcel and the insurance picture.

    5

    Confirm no special assessments. Verify on the tax bill that no district assessment applies.

    A Small Market With Room to Negotiate

    Shangri La is compact — 248 homes total, with just four currently listed for sale. That thin inventory combines with 12 months of supply to produce a buyer-leaning market: there is enough for sale relative to the pace of sales that buyers can negotiate on price and terms rather than compete in bidding situations.

    The pricing story cuts two ways. Zoomed out, values are up 109% since 2012, a long climb that reflects the broader Daytona Beach market. Zoomed in, the trailing year shows a 24.1% pullback — but that reading comes from only three closings in the current window, a sample too small to treat as a firm trend. The market heat score of 39 backs up the buyer-leaning label: this is not a market where sellers set the terms right now.
